IFC_FIR_OP_CMD0 issues command for execution without checking flash readiness. It may cause problem if flash is not ready. Instead use IFC_FIR_OP_CW0 which Wait for tWB time and poll R/B to return high or time-out, before issuing command.
NAND_CMD_READID command implemention does not fulfill above requirement. So update its programming.
